I am getting to grips with using Comsol and have been following the "Permanent Magnet" tutorial model. I have adapted the model slightly so that the magnet is now just a bar at the centre of a cube of air and the iron rod is removed. I am able to use Magnetic Insulation as the boundary condition at the sides of the air cube and do get a reasonable result, but if I use a streamline plot of the magnetic flux density the effects of the relatively small size block of air become obvious.
I have been trying to implement infinite boundary conditions using the "Infinite Elements" option to prevent this distortion, but I find that the two help pages in the manual useless in explaining the feature. I do not know if I should be just applying the condition to the air block, or capping each axis in the model with an air block with the infinite element condition applied as indicated by the images in the manual.
When I attempt to solve the problem with Infinite Elements enabled I receive an error: "Feature: Stationary Solver 1 (sol1/s1), Error: Undefined value found.". I still want to use the boundary condition of magnetic insulation at infinity, but the only condition available under "Infinite Elements I" is Magnetic Flux Conservation. I suspect that this is the problem, but can anyone help in identifying the correct way to set the infinite boundary conditions for this model?
Thank you for any help you can provide.
